India records best-ever performance at World Skills 2019

Team India notches its best-ever performance in global competition, which is considered to be the ‘Olympics’ of global skill competitions.

India has notched its best-ever performance at the just-concluded 45th World Skills 2019 competition in Kazan, Russia. Nineteen skilled young Indian professionals have won honours for the country.
